I also have taken a cheap line-level base-board heater thermostat and made a small light-bulb heater for inside my fermentation chamber to make sure things didn't get too cold in the winter time (chamber is a fridge in the garage). But, that thing had a limitation on how many amps it could handle.

I would be sure to check the amp load limitation on your thermostat and the amps your fridge wants to draw before using it as a thermostat to kick on your fridge's compressor. You could fry something (probably just the thermostat, but...). I was not worried about kicking on a light-bulb for heat with mine, because that's small potatoes.

As for extending the wire on the thermistor (which is actually a temp-sensitive resistor and not a diode)... do you find that it is still pretty accurate? I had considering doing something like this on my Heat-A-Ma-Bob(TM), but started to wonder how much the extra resistance of the long wires would skew the temp reading. Probably not a big deal... you would just have to compensate for that and set the thermostat a little higher or lower than what you really wanted.

Yes its a resistor ...brain fart.... anyways it seems just as accurate as it was before I modded it. And as i said earlier I use it in my fermentation chamber that is basically just a foam insulation box with an ice-pack and a computer case-fan in it for air circulation.

The thermister gets taped to the carboy, and kicks the fan on/off depending on its temp.

It's important to note on here that that thermostat is a 24VAC (not exactly a common power rating) thermostat. Also (I couldn't find a spec sheet on it) most likely it won't have much output power. Probably in MiliAmps. It won't be able to be used to operate a chest freezer, refridgerator, or heating element without the integration of relays. Don't know what you'll need for a power supply. These are meant as replacements for your furnace and AC temp control.
